2. Reliable and Efficient Power Systems

Reliable power is essential when you’re living life on the road. Whether parked at a scenic spot or camping off the grid, you need a motorhome that keeps your devices and your fridge running.

Look for models with built-in solar panels, battery storage, and efficient generators. Avida motorhomes, for instance, are known for their robust electrical setups, making them perfect for long-term travel. If you’re considering repossessed motorhomes for sale on the Gold Coast, always check the condition of the electrical systems, as poorly maintained batteries can cost a fortune to replace.

Key Tips:

  • Inspect battery health and the age of solar panels.
  • Choose a motorhome with energy-efficient appliances.
  • Ensure a backup power source, like a generator or shore power hookup.

3. Durability and Build Quality

Your motorhome is not just a vehicle; it’s your home on wheels. Durability is non-negotiable, especially if you tackle varied terrain across Australia. Whether you’re eyeing a brand-new model or browsing used Avida motorhomes for sale, the build quality should be at the top of your checklist.

Check the frame and body for signs of rust or water damage. A well-built motorhome withstands Australia’s harsh climate without compromising comfort. Reputable brands like Avida pride themselves on producing robust, long-lasting motorhomes that endure both time and adventure.

Key Tips:

  • Inspect joints and seals for leaks or rust.
  • Take a test drive to see how it is handled on the road.
  • Ask for maintenance records to verify the vehicle’s upkeep.

  3. Is it better to buy a new or used motorhome? Buying new ensures you get the latest features and no wear and tear, but it comes at a higher cost. Used motorhomes offer significant savings but may require maintenance. It depends on your budget and preferences.
  4. How can I finance a motorhome purchase? Many dealerships offer financing options, and you can also consider loans from banks or credit unions. Compare interest rates and terms to find the best deal.
  5. What maintenance is required for motorhomes? Regular maintenance includes engine checks, plumbing system inspections, battery upkeep, and interior cleaning. Seasonal maintenance might consist of checking seals and roof integrity.
